如何用java开发一个微信小程序

如何用java开发一个微信小程序

作者:Joshua Lee发布时间:2026-02-10阅读时长:0 分钟阅读次数:6

用户关注问题

Q
怎样用Java后台支持微信小程序的开发?

我想用Java语言为微信小程序开发一个后台接口,应该如何设计和实现?

A

使用Java开发微信小程序后台的基本步骤

可以使用Spring Boot或其他Java框架搭建RESTful API服务,处理微信小程序发起的请求。首先需要在微信公众平台申请小程序账号并获取AppID和AppSecret,随后通过这些凭证实现用户登录验证和数据交互。后端应提供数据接口,支持JSON数据格式返回,以便小程序前端调用。同时,确保接口安全,使用HTTPS协议加密数据传输。

Q
Java如何与微信小程序前端进行数据通信?

Java编写的服务端怎样与微信小程序的前端实现高效数据交换?

A

利用RESTful接口实现数据通信

微信小程序前端通过微信提供的wx.request()方法发起HTTP请求,向Java后台暴露的API接口发送数据或者请求数据。Java后台应返回标准的JSON格式数据,方便小程序解析和渲染。该通信方式适用于读取用户信息、提交表单数据、获取动态内容等场景。为保证性能和稳定性,需要对接口进行优化和异常处理。

Q
使用Java开发微信小程序需要注意哪些安全问题?

在开发微信小程序时,Java后台开发过程中应如何保障用户数据安全?

A

微信小程序Java后台安全注意点

一是对用户请求进行身份验证,确保只有合法用户能够访问受限接口;二是避免明文传输敏感信息,采用HTTPS协议;三是做好数据校验和过滤,防止SQL注入和跨站脚本攻击;四是保证服务器端的密钥和凭证安全,不在客户端暴露关键秘钥;五是及时更新依赖库,修复已知安全漏洞,保障整体系统的安全性。